Understanding Noise Levels on the Road

When it comes to motorcycle riding, noise can be more than just an annoyance – it can lead to serious hearing damage over time. At highway speeds, the sound of wind rushing against your helmet can exceed 100 decibels, which is comparable to the noise level of a chainsaw. Prolonged exposure to such intense noise can lead to Noise-Induced Hearing Loss (NIHL), a condition that many riders might not consider until it’s too late.

Imagine being on a long ride, enjoying the scenic views, but feeling a constant ringing in your ears afterward. That’s not just fatigue; it could be the early signs of hearing damage. Investing in high-quality earplugs specifically designed for motorcycle riding can significantly reduce these noise levels, allowing you to focus on the road and enjoy the ride without compromising your hearing.

Furthermore, a quieter ride can enhance your experience as it reduces fatigue and the stress that comes with prolonged exposure to noise. With earplugs, you’ll not only protect your ears but also make every journey more enjoyable, allowing you to immerse yourself fully in the sights and sounds of the ride without risking auditory harm.

Different Types of Earplugs and Their Benefits

When choosing earplugs for motorcycle riding, it’s essential to understand the different types available on the market. Foam earplugs are often the go-to choice for many riders due to their affordability and comfort. These disposable plugs are made from soft foam that expands to fit the shape of your ear canal, providing an excellent seal against noise. However, while they can reduce volume, they may attenuate sounds too much, making it challenging to hear important road sounds like sirens or horns.

On the other hand, custom-molded earplugs, while pricier, are tailored to fit your ears perfectly. This ensures not only superior comfort for long rides but also optimal noise reduction without completely isolating you from your surroundings. This way, you can enjoy a quieter ride while still being aware of critical auditory cues from your environment.

For riders who want the best of both worlds, consider the hybrid options available, such as filtered earplugs. These allow for adjustable noise reduction levels, letting you hear essential sounds while silencing potentially harmful noise levels. Regardless of the option you choose, understanding the pros and cons can ensure you’re equipped with the best earplugs suited for your riding style and comfort.

Safety Considerations When Riding with Earplugs

While earplugs can significantly reduce noise, it’s crucial to consider safety aspects when wearing them while riding. One of the primary concerns is the potential to mute essential sounds, such as approaching vehicles or emergency sirens. To strike the right balance, consider using earplugs that preserve important frequencies while reducing harmful noise levels. That way, you’re still aware of your surroundings without jeopardizing your hearing.

Additionally, it’s a good idea to test your earplugs in a safe environment before hitting the road. Spend some time wearing them while sitting on your motorcycle in a controlled space, allowing you to gauge how much sound insulation they provide. This testing phase can give you insights into whether you can still hear vital sounds or not.

Lastly, it’s important to familiarize yourself with the soundscape of your riding environment. Knowing typical noise levels from street traffic or other road users can help you determine if your level of auditory awareness is suitable while wearing earplugs. The key is balance: protect your hearing, but remain vigilant and aware of your surroundings to ensure enthusiastic and safe riding adventures.

3. Material

The material of your earplugs can make a significant difference in comfort and effectiveness. Common materials include foam, silicone, and wax. Foam earplugs are often the go-to choice because they expand within your ear canal, creating a snug fit that effectively blocks noise. However, they can also get a bit hot after prolonged use.

Silicone earplugs, on the other hand, can provide a more durable option and are typically washable, making them reusable. They also tend to be a bit more comfortable for long-term wear. When choosing the best earplugs for motorcycle riding, think about how often you’ll use them and what material feels best for your ears.

How do I properly clean and maintain reusable earplugs?

Cleaning and maintaining reusable earplugs is pretty straightforward, and it’s an essential part of ensuring they last a long time and stay hygienic. Start by rinsing them under warm water. Use a mild soap or gentle detergent to wash away any dirt and oils. After that, give them a thorough rinse and let them air dry completely before storing them in a clean case. Regular cleaning can prevent buildup and help maintain their shape.

It’s also a good idea to check your earplugs for any signs of wear and tear after regular use. If you notice any cracks or if they no longer fit snugly, it might be time to replace them. Regular maintenance not only increases their lifespan but ensures you get the maximum benefit from your riding gear while staying safe on the road.
